OT: Question for you bloggers
I have a bike blog at Wordpress.com. This week, whenever and wherever I view it, the pictures appear pixelated (except for the one in the header which I uploaded from our hard drive). All the photos are stored at Shutterfly and I insert a link to the photo on the blog.
Does anyone know why this happens? Is this an inherent problem with linking back to this, or any, photo site?
I'd prefer to upload pics straight from my computer as it saves having to first upload all the pics to a host, then link to them on the blog. And, if the hosting site goes away......
Anyone have a clue?

Your photos links are to very low resolution images. Perhaps you are linking to the thumbnails rather than the higher resolution images?
I don't do Shutterfly. Do they allow linking? If not, this may be their way of telling you "Don't do this"
Note that they are also very distorted.
If Shutterfly doesn't work out try Flickr

Don't know if you use Photoshop or another image editing program, Yen, but I always select "Save for Web" if I will be using a picture on my blog. That optimizes the picture (much smaller file size) so it will display in full, but load quickly. And I upload them from my computer.
